8,703,304 is a composite number, even.

This number doesn't have a permanent NumberWiki page yet — what you see below is computed live. Pages get added to the permanent index when they're notable (years, primes, curated, etc.).

8,703,304 (eight million seven hundred three thousand three hundred four) is an even 7-digit number. It is a composite number with 16 divisors, and factors as 2³ × 401 × 2,713.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x84CD48.
